The pavement of Nam Ky Khoi Nghia road is considered the most beautiful and most expensive in HCM City because it is paved with granite, but it is treated badly by residents.

It becomes the place for rubbish and construction materials.

Motorists drive on the sidewalk.

The pavement becomes a parking lot for motorbikes.

A bus stop becomes a motorbike repair shop.

Small traders also open their shops on the sidewalk.

It is also dug up.
